#1970AE Color
#1970AE is rgb(25, 112, 174) in RGB, hsl(205, 75%, 39%) in HSL, and about cmyk(86%, 36%, 0%, 32%) in CMYK. It has no registered color name of its own — the closest is Honolulu Blue (#006DB0), very hard to tell apart at ΔE 3.31. White text is the more readable choice on this background.

#1970AE Channel Values
How #1970AE breaks down in each color model. Hue is measured in degrees around the color wheel; saturation, lightness, and the CMYK inks are percentages.
| Model | Channels | Notes |
|---|---|---|
| RGB | R 25 · G 112 · B 174 | 8-bit channels as sent to the display |
| HSL | H 205° · S 75% · L 39% | Easiest model for building lighter and darker variants |
| HSV | H 205° · S 86% · V 68% | Matches the picker in most design tools |
| CMYK | C 86% · M 36% · Y 0% · K 32% | Approximate ink mix; confirm with an ICC profile before printing |
| Luminance | 5.29:1 vs white · 3.97:1 vs black | WCAG 2.2 relative-luminance contrast ratios |

#1970AE Frequently Asked Questions
What color is #1970AE?
#1970AE is a dark blue — rgb(25, 112, 174) in RGB and hsl(205, 75%, 39%) in HSL. It carries no registered color name of its own; the closest named color is Honolulu Blue (#006DB0), which is very hard to tell apart at a CIE76 distance of 3.31.
What is the RGB value of #1970AE?
#1970AE is rgb(25, 112, 174) — red 25, green 112, and blue 174 on the 0-255 scale.
What is the CMYK value of #1970AE?
#1970AE converts to approximately cmyk(86%, 36%, 0%, 32%). CMYK output is a mathematical approximation for planning; confirm production print colors with your printer and ICC profile.
Should text on #1970AE be black or white?
White text is the more readable choice. #1970AE scores 5.29:1 against white and 3.97:1 against black, and WCAG 2.2 asks for at least 4.5:1 for normal body text.
Can I write #1970AE as a CSS color keyword?
No. #1970AE is not one of the CSS color keywords, so it has to be written as a hex, rgb() or hsl() value. The closest keyword is steelblue (#4682B4) at a CIE76 distance of 10.72, which is visibly different.
